Federal judge blasts Wells Fargo for overdraft fees

A lawsuit in California concerning Wells Fargo and its procedures regarding overdraft fees finished just lately. Wells Fargo was ruled to have unfairly charged people with overdraft fees, and Judge William Alsup ordered the financial institution to repay them.
